# LogicLLaMA Model Card
## Model details
LogicLLaMA is a language model that translates natural-language (NL) statements into first-order logic (FOL) rules.
It is trained by fine-tuning the LLaMA-7B model on the [MALLS](https://huggingface.co/datasets/yuan-yang/MALLS-v0) dataset.
**Model type:**
This repo contains the LoRA delta weights for naive correction LogicLLaMA, which, given a pair of the NL statement and a predicted FOL rule,
corrects the potential errors in the predicted FOL rule.
This is used as a downstream model together with ChatGPT, where ChatGPT does the "heavy lifting" by predicting the initial translated FOL rule
and then LogicLLaMA refines the rule by correcting potential errors.
In our [experiments](https://arxiv.org/abs/2305.15541), this mode yields better performance than ChatGPT and direction translation LogicLLaMA.
